📣 极限科技诚招搜索运维工程师(Elasticsearch/Easysearch)- 全职/北京 👉 : 立即申请加入

引言:同源不同路,差异在“本土化”与“合规性” #

Easysearch 与 Elasticsearch(简称 ES)师出同门——Easysearch 衍生自 ES 7.10.2 版本(ES 最后一个 Apache 2.0 开源协议版本),但后续发展路径完全不同。ES 转向 SSPL/ELv2 协议,侧重全功能生态;Easysearch 坚守 “本土化适配+合规优先”,聚焦国内企业核心需求。两者核心差异集中在协议、性能、功能适配、商业模式四大维度,以下逐一拆解。

一、协议与合规:核心风险差异 #

对比维度ElasticsearchEasysearch
开源协议7.11+ 为 SSPL/ELv2 双重授权社区免费+商业授权,采用商用友好协议,商业使用自由
合规风险对外提供云服务需公开全服务栈代码,泄露商业机密;商业使用需付费授权无强制开源要求,二次开发、云托管均自由;无商业授权绑定风险
国产化适配基本无国产 CPU/OS 适配,不符合信创要求全面适配鲲鹏/飞腾等国产 CPU、麒麟/统信 UOS 等国产系统,通过多项信创认证

关键差异:ES 的 SSPL 协议属于“强传染性”协议,企业若基于其搭建商业化服务,需公开自研管理工具、API 等核心代码;而 Easysearch 彻底规避该风险,同时满足国内信创合规要求。

二、技术架构与性能:轻量高效是核心优势 #

1. 基础架构差异 #

  • 分布式设计:两者均支持索引分片、副本备份,但 Easysearch 在分片分配与故障恢复相关参数上进行了工程化优化,结合实际生产场景,降低了节点故障时的恢复开销,并改善了集群恢复过程中的稳定性与可预测性
  • 存储机制:Easysearch 引入 ZSTD 压缩,相同数据存储占用仅为 ES 的 1/3(8.7GB 日志压缩后仅占 1.4GB)。
  • 安装包大小:ES 安装包 500+MB,Easysearch 只有大约 50MB左右,部署灵活度大幅提升。

2. 核心性能数据对比 #

性能指标ElasticsearchEasysearch差异亮点
写入性能基准水平提升 40%-70%优化批量写入机制,降低 I/O 损耗
查询延迟排序查询延迟 1 秒左右排序查询延迟优化 97%(0.03 秒响应)堆外内存优化,减少 GC 耗时
资源占用CPU/内存占用较高降低 10%-30%精简无用功能,优化资源调度

三、功能特性:聚焦“国内企业刚需” #

1. 中文支持:开箱即用 vs 额外配置 #

  • Elasticsearch:原生无中文分词能力,需手动安装 IK 等第三方插件,配置复杂且易兼容出错。
  • Easysearch:内置 IK 企业版、拼音分词器,支持简繁体转换、同义词识别,中文检索准确率和速度均优于 ES。

2. 安全功能:付费解锁 vs 默认全量 #

  • Elasticsearch:高级安全功能(LDAP 集成、字段级权限)需购买 X-Pack 付费授权,基础版仅支持简单认证。
  • Easysearch:默认提供企业级安全能力——LDAP/AD 集成、索引级/文档级/字段级权限控制、国密算法(SM2/SM3/SM4)、审计日志,无需额外付费。

3. 运维便利性:依赖配套 vs 一键上手 #

  • Elasticsearch:需搭配 Kibana 实现可视化管理,部署复杂;分片均衡、故障恢复需手动干预。
  • Easysearch:内置 Web 管理界面,无需额外部署;支持一键部署、自动分片均衡、故障节点自动恢复,搭配 INFINI Console 可实现多集群统一管控。

四、商业与生态:绑定付费 vs 灵活适配 #

对比维度ElasticsearchEasysearch
商业成本高级功能(安全、监控)需年付授权费,TCO 较高社区版全功能免费,商业版按需付费,成本比 ES 低 40%-60%
技术支持依赖国外团队,中文支持响应慢国内团队本土化支持,7×24 小时响应,适配国内业务场景
生态兼容性插件丰富,但部分需付费;与国产工具适配差100% 兼容 ES 7.x REST API,现有 ES 代码/SDK 无需修改即可迁移;适配 Logstash、Kibana 等主流工具

核心差异总结 #

两者的本质差异是“通用型生态”与“本土化刚需”的选择:

  • ES 优势在全功能生态、国际化支持,但协议合规风险高、国产化适配缺失、成本高;
  • Easysearch 优势在“合规无风险+轻量高效+国产适配”,精准解决国内企业“怕违规、怕复杂、怕成本高”的核心痛点,尤其适合金融、政务、运营商等强合规行业。